At the big banks and the boutique investment shops, an optimistic consensus has taken hold: the US stock market will rally in 2026 for a fourth straight year, marking the longest winning streak in nearly two decades. There’s plenty of angst about the risks to the bull run that’s pushed the S&P 500 Index up some 90% since its October 2022 low. The artificial-intelligence boom could turn to bust. The economy — and the Federal Reserve ’s interest-rate decisions — could defy expectations. And President Donald Trump ’s second year could bring even more unanticipated shocks than his first.
